What does a data entry assistant do?

As a data entry assistant, you type information from handwritten documents, phone calls, or recordings into a computer system and keep that data organized. You may also have job duties similar to those of an administrative assistant, such as answering phone calls, sorting mail, and greeting clients or visitors in the office. The qualifications you need for a career as a data entry clerk are a high school diploma or GED certificate and typing and computer skills. You need a bachelor’s degree for some data entry jobs.

What is the difference between Data Entry Assistant vs Data Coordinator?

AspectData Entry AssistantData Coordinator
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ic computer skillsHigh school diploma; some roles may prefer additional certifications
Work EnvironmentOffice settings, data entry centersOffice environments, data management departments
Job ResponsibilitiesInputting data, maintaining databases, verifying accuracyOverseeing data collection, managing data quality, coordinating data projects
Industry UsageCommon in administrative, healthcare, retail sectorsUsed in healthcare, finance, research organizations

While both roles involve working with data, a Data Entry Assistant primarily focuses on inputting and verifying data, whereas a Data Coordinator manages data quality and oversees data processes. The roles often overlap in skills but differ in scope and responsibilities.

What are some common challenges faced by data entry assistants, and how can they be managed?

Data Entry Assistants often encounter challenges such as handling large volumes of data, maintaining high accuracy under tight deadlines, and managing repetitive tasks. To manage these challenges, it's important to develop strong organizational habits, regularly double-check work for errors, and use keyboard shortcuts or data management tools to improve efficiency. Many teams foster a supportive environment where colleagues can share workload during peak periods, and supervisors may offer training to help improve speed and accuracy.
